Downpipes Replacement: Essential Guide for Homeowners
Downpipes, likewise called drains or leaders, play a crucial function in the overall health of a structure's drain system. These pipelines are accountable for directing rainwater from the roof to the ground, preventing water damage and safeguarding the structural stability of the home. Nevertheless, like any other part of a home's facilities, downpipes can wear over time and need replacement. This guide will supply homeowners with everything they require to understand about downpipe replacement, including signs of wear and tear, materials, cost breakdowns, and often asked concerns.
Indications You Need to Replace Your Downpipes
Identifying the requirement for a downpipe replacement can conserve homeowners from comprehensive water damage and costly repair work. Below are key signs to look for:
Signs of DeteriorationImplicationsCracks or leaks in the pipesProspective water damage to structures, Fascias Services - Xajhuang.com - walls, and ceilingsRust or rust (for metal pipes)Reduced efficiency and danger of hole developmentObstructions or regular clogsIneffective drainage leading to overflow or floodingWetness or mold on wallsSuggests prolonged water exposure due to faulty downpipesDrooping or misalignmentPoor installation or weathering effects drainage flow
If any of these indications are observed, it's essential to assess the situation without delay to avoid more extreme damage.
Products for Downpipe Replacement
When thinking about downpipe replacement, the option of product is crucial. Various products have unique benefits and disadvantages. Below is a breakdown of the typical products used in downpipe building:
MaterialAdvantagesDownsidesPVCLight-weight, rust-proof, economicalCan be breakable in extreme coldMetal (Aluminum, Steel)Durable, high tensile strengthProne to rust (if neglected)CopperBrings in minimal debris, extremely long-lastingHigh expense, can be susceptible to theftCast IronVery little expansion/contractionHeavy, more challenging to installVinylCorrosion-resistant, easy to set upLess durable than PVC/metal types
Homeowners should select a material that suits their budget plan, climate, and aesthetic preferences.
The Replacement Process: Step-by-Step
Changing downpipes includes careful preparation and execution. Below is a thorough guide to the replacement process:
Step 1: Assess the Situation
Before replacement, it's necessary to carry out a comprehensive evaluation of the existing Downpipes Replacement. Try to find signs of damage, and determine the needed length of brand-new downpipes.
Step 2: Gather Necessary Tools and Materials
A normal list of tools and products might consist of:
New downpipesConnectors and bracketsDrill and drill bitsScrewdriversCaulking weaponDetermining tapeLadderAction 3: Remove Old Downpipes
Carefully detach the old downpipes from the structural points. Take care not to harm any surrounding products or fixtures.
Step 4: Prepare New Downpipes
Measure and cut the new downpipes according to the required lengths. Assemble the new pipelines according to the design strategy.
Step 5: Install New Downpipes
Securely attach the brand-new downpipes using brackets and ports. Guarantee that the pipes have an appropriate angle for ideal drainage flow.
Action 6: Seal Connections
Use caulking to seal any joints or connections to prevent leaks. Let it cure as per the manufacturer's instructions.
Action 7: Test the System
When everything is installed, test the system by simulating rainfall to ensure that the downpipes are draining pipes water efficiently.

Maintenance Tips for Downpipes
To prolong the life-span of downpipes and minimize the requirement for future replacements, homeowners must think about the following maintenance ideas:
Regular Inspections: Conduct biannual inspections of downpipes for damage or signs of clogs.Cleaning up: Remove particles from downpipe openings and gutters to guarantee free circulation of rainwater.Inspect Connections: Ensure all joints are sealed firmly to avoid leakages.Screen Weather Impacts: After heavy storms, examine for any new signs of damage or obstructions.Professional Service: Consider working with an expert to perform detailed inspections and maintenance as required.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
